Sportradar has gained the global data and betting streaming rights to the ATP, starting in 2024.  Following what was described as an extensive RFP process led by Tennis Data Innovations (TDI), this RFP process was initiated by the group in January 2023 and saw five bidders submit ‘detailed proposals’ across multiple rounds for a six-year rights cycle. Severine Riviere has become the latest senior hire at Sportradar, joining the company as Chief People Officer (CPO) to spearhead its human resources policies. The Swiss sports technology and data company will hold oversight of the group’s HR strategy, including talent management, leadership development, employee rewards and cultivation of workplace culture. Sportradar AG has upgraded its full-year 2022 financial outlook, reflecting a consecutive quarter of “exceeded growth outperforming corporate expectations”.  Publishing its Q3 trading update, the Nasdaq sportstech group registered corporate revenues of €179m, up 31% on 2021 comparative results of €137m. Sportradar and FanDuel Group have confirmed the signing this week of a new official NBA data partnership which will run through to the end of the 2030-31 season. Sportradar AG has upgraded its year guidance, forecasting full-year revenues in the new range of €695-to-€715m – representing a prospective growth of 24% over fiscal 2021 results.
